DRIVERS are being reminded that one of the worst streets for potholes in York is set to close for work from tomorrow (July 25).
As The press reported last week, Shipton Street in Clifton is set to close from 8am tomorrow until 5pm on Friday (July 28) for resurfacing works.
It's not clear at this stage whether it's just for some of the numerous deep pothotles to be patched up or whether it's for a full resurface.
